Answer:

Abbe Dubois was a French missionary who came to India and settled at Ganjam near Srirangapatna. He adopted the local culture and customs and lived like a sage. The local people respectfully called him ‘Dodda Swami’. He wrote a book ‘Hindu manners, Customs and Ceremonies’. In this book, he has written about the customs, values, thoughts, festivals and Varnashrama system of India. He returned to France after living here for 24 years.
